The Art of Aging: Three Years and Beyond
The "Extra Añejo" title is earned, not given. To qualify, a tequila must be aged for a minimum of three years in oak barrels, often barrels that previously held bourbon or wine. This extended time allows the spirit to develop an incredible depth of character. But the clock starts long before the tequila ever touches a barrel. The blue weber agave plant itself takes around seven years to mature before it can be harvested. When you do the math, that means the beautiful Extra Añejo Tequila in your glass is the result of at least a decade of patience and care. It’s a slow, deliberate process that simply can't be rushed.
Extra Añejo vs. Other Tequilas: What's the Difference?
So how does an Extra Añejo stand apart from its siblings? It all comes down to time. While a Blanco tequila is unaged and bottled soon after distillation, capturing the pure, raw essence of agave, aged tequilas rest in barrels. A Reposado is aged for two months to a year, and an Añejo for one to three years. Extra Añejo takes it a step further, going beyond that three-year mark. This prolonged contact with the wood is what gives it a darker, richer color and a smoother, more complex flavor profile. How to Spot an Authentic, High-Quality Bottle
When you’re investing in a premium spirit, you want to be sure you’re getting the real deal. The first thing to look for is the official labeling. A bottle marked "Extra Añejo" confirms the tequila has been aged in oak for at least three years, meeting the strict standards of the Tequila Regulatory Council. Also, always check that the label says "100% de Agave." This ensures the tequila is made purely from the blue Weber agave plant. You’ll notice aged tequilas have a beautiful golden or amber color, but they are never labeled "gold." That term is often reserved for mixtos, which are lower-quality tequilas.

For the Love of Oak, Vanilla, and Caramel
If you appreciate the smooth, rich character of a well-aged spirit, you’ll feel right at home with Extra Añejos that lead with notes of oak, vanilla, and caramel. These classic flavors are the signature of the aging process, absorbed directly from the oak barrels over three or more years. The wood imparts a gentle warmth and structure, while the toasted interior of the barrel releases sweet, comforting notes of vanilla bean and buttery caramel. These tequilas are often incredibly smooth and approachable, making them a perfect introduction to the category or a reliable favorite for those who love a decadent, mellow sip. Exploring Notes of Chocolate, Spice, and Fruit
Beyond the classic sweet and woody notes, many Extra Añejos offer a more intricate tasting experience with hints of chocolate, spice, and fruit. These complex flavors often come from the unique type of barrel used, such as French oak or casks that previously held sherry or cognac. You might discover notes of rich dark chocolate, a gentle warmth from cinnamon or black pepper, or the subtle sweetness of dried fruits like figs and cherries. These tequilas are wonderfully layered and reveal new dimensions with every sip. They are fantastic for pairing with a fine cigar or enjoying as a digestif after a meal. How to Read Tasting Notes and Reviews
When you’re browsing online, the tasting notes are your best friend. Don’t be intimidated by the terminology; it’s simpler than it sounds. The "nose" or "aroma" refers to what you smell. The "palate" describes the flavors you taste when you sip it. Finally, the "finish" is the lingering taste left after you swallow. Look for descriptions that match flavors you already know you enjoy in other foods or drinks. Customer reviews can also offer valuable insight into whether a tequila is sweet, spicy, or smooth. How to Properly Taste Extra Añejo
To fully appreciate the craftsmanship in every bottle, you’ll want to savor your Extra Añejo. Forget the shot glass; this spirit deserves a proper tasting glass, like a Glencairn or a Riedel tequila glass, which helps concentrate the aromas. Start by observing the color, a rich amber or mahogany earned from its time in the barrel. Give the glass a gentle swirl and take a moment to inhale the complex scents. When you’re ready to taste, take a small sip and let it coat your tongue for a few seconds before swallowing. This allows you to experience the full spectrum of flavors as they unfold. Myth: All Extra Añejos Are Created Equal
It’s easy to assume that any bottle labeled "Extra Añejo" offers a similar experience, but that couldn't be further from the truth. The designation simply means the tequila has been aged in oak barrels for a minimum of three years. The real magic lies in the details of that aging process. The type of barrel used, whether it’s French or American oak, or if it previously held bourbon or wine, dramatically shapes the final flavor. A distillery’s unique methods and the quality of the initial blanco tequila also play a huge role. Myth: You Can Only Drink It Neat
Sipping an Extra Añejo neat is a fantastic way to appreciate its complex layers of flavor, and it’s how most connoisseurs prefer it. But it’s certainly not the only way. Don't let anyone tell you there are strict rules you have to follow. If you find the spirit a bit intense, try adding a single, large ice cube or a few drops of water. This can soften the alcohol and open up new aromas and flavors. You can even use an Extra Añejo to create a truly luxurious, spirit-forward cocktail like an Old Fashioned. The goal is to enjoy your tequila, so feel free to experiment.
